✨ The 3 Key Ingredients
| Ingredient | Amount |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Yellow cake mix | 1 box (18.25 oz) | Use a classic brand like Betty Crocker |
| Cream cheese | 1 block (8 oz), softened | Full-fat gives best texture |
| Cherry pie filling | 1 can (21 oz) | Swap with blueberry, apple, or peach if preferred |
Pantry Essentials:
- ½ c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, melted
- 1 large egg
- Pinch of salt
💡 Pro Tips
- Always use full-fat cream cheese—low-fat won’t set right.
- Stir the crust mixture until crumbly; avoid overmixing.
- Glass dishes = even baking + perfect for gifting.
🥣 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Make the Crust & Cheesecake Layer
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ease two 8×8-inch glass dishes (or one 9×13).
- Mix cake mix, melted butter, egg, and salt.
- Press half into each dish (or all into a 9×13).
- Beat cream cheese until smooth, then spread evenly over the crust.
2. Add the Cherries
- Spoon cherry pie filling over cream cheese, leaving a small border.
- Optional: swirl gently with a knife for a marbled effect.
3. Bake to Perfection
- Bake 25–30 minutes until edges are golden and center is set.
- Cool completely, then chill at least 2 hours for clean slices.
4. Serve & Share
- Cut into squares; dust with powdered sugar if desired.
- Gift one pan with a note or ribbon for instant cheer.

🧊 Make-Ahead & Storage
- Fridge: Up to 5 days; flavor improves overnight
- Freeze: Slice, wrap in parchment, freeze up to 2 months. Thaw in fridge
